On Monday, Justin Timberlake appeared virtually on The Ellen DeGeneres Show and disclosed that he and wife Jessica Biel welcomed their second son named Phineas.
The 39-year-old told Ellen “He's awesome and so cute. Nobody's sleeping. But we're thrilled. We're thrilled and couldn't be happier. Very grateful”.
Timberlake was asked about parenting two kids instead of one, to which he responded “We don't see each other anymore. It's a lot of fun. I guess the saying goes go from a zone defense to a man-to-man really quickly. It's great. Silas is super excited”.
Justin was also asked how his 5-year-old son Silas is with the new baby boy. He replied, “Right now he's very much liking it. Phin can't walk yet or chase him down, so we'll see what happens”.
Palmer star revealed Silas likes video games and added “But he's into Legos and tennis. We got him a Nintendo Switch. It's just like, child crack”.
The star further added, “He likes golf, but I'm not pressing it. I want him to like it if he likes it. He's fast and active so he's very good at tennis”.
